Matchday Thread: Port Vale v Charlton Athletic


Fosse69

Recommended Posts

Pre-match, match, and post match comments welcome.

 

The visit of the other Valiants from the Valley may include the flying pigs seen in their 3-0 win over Coventry. Hopefully we will be able to deal better with their bustling striker Magennis than did Cov.

 

Time for a new formation? Injured players coming back?

The problem is with our long injury list we don't have too many viable alternatives in the attacking third.

 

I too think we might as well have a go with two up front and although he doesn't look completely ready yet I think I'd stick big Cecilia up there alongside Jones and revisit who plays on the wings.

 

Persist with Hart perhaps but consider Shalaj or Kelly, even though I'm not sure they are up to it for 90 minutes.

 

The worry is that Foley is probably injured now so we need to replace him too.

 

It's also time for Purkiss to stand up and be counted. He's been poor this season.
